Output 43ad67ffdb3d8af94433f236359bbf17c958bd0c34757b3ade6678d3677cae38:0

value
3365633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f161473cfddffabfad34866e18934b634b24135f OP_EQUAL
address
3PhKJnehMQPK1NvtTYLZnMhPLYp79GCHXh
transaction
43ad67ffdb3d8af94433f236359bbf17c958bd0c34757b3ade6678d3677cae38